How much do manager international j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ager international in Quebec is $92,690.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$58,500.00 and $122,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a manager international?

Manager International positions refer to roles where individuals oversee and coordinate business operations, projects, or teams across different countries or regions. These managers handle tasks such as developing global strategies, managing cross-cultural teams, ensuring compliance with international regulations, and identifying opportunities for expansion in foreign markets. They require strong communication skills, cultural awareness, and experience in international business environments to succeed. The position often involves frequent travel and collaboration with diverse stakeholders to achieve organizational goals on a global scale.

What are some common challenges faced by a manager international when leading cross-cultural teams?

As a Manager International, one of the most common challenges is navigating cultural differences in communication, work styles, and expectations. Building trust and ensuring effective collaboration across time zones can require flexibility and strong interpersonal skills. Additionally, adapting management approaches to suit diverse team dynamics and legal requirements in different countries is crucial for success. Proactive communication and cultural sensitivity are essential tools for overcoming these challenges and fostering a cohesive, productive team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ager international,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manager International, you need expertise in international business operations, cross-cultural management, and a relevant degree such as international relations or business administration. Familiarity with global regulatory compliance, ERP systems, and foreign language proficiency is often required. Exceptional communication, adaptability, and negotiation skills help build effective relationships across diverse markets. These abilities are crucial for navigating complex global environments and achieving organizational objectives in international contexts.

What is the difference between Manager International vs Logistics Coordinator?

AspectManager InternationalLogistics Coordinator
CredentialsBachelor's degree, often with international business or management certific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les prefer certifications in logistics or supply chain
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, overseeing international operations and teamsWarehouse, shipping, and transportation settings coordinating shipments
Employer & Industry UsageMultinational companies, import/export firms, global trade organizationsLogistics companies, shipping firms, supply chain departments

The Manager International typically handles strategic planning and oversees international operations, requiring management skills and relevant certifications. In contrast, a Logistics Coordinator focuses on coordinating shipments and logistics activities, often with more operational responsibilities. Both roles are essential in global trade but differ in scope and responsibilities.
